2017-08-08 87 views

回答

1

對於沒有參考創建交貨銷售訂單,你可以使用BAPI_OUTB_DELIVERY_CREATENOREF。

參數|選擇。|說明

進口

  • SHIP_POINT | |裝運點
  • DLV_TYPE | |交貨類型
  • SALESORG | |銷售組織
  • DISTR_CHAN | |分銷渠道
  • DIVISION | |分部
  • SHIP_TO | |收貨方
  • DATE_USAGE | X |在日期中使用日期
  • DEBUG_FLG | X |強制終止(ALE分析)

出口

  • 交付| X |首先生成的交貨
  • NUM_DELIVERIES | X |發貨次數

參數|選擇|方向|說明

  • DATES | |導入|交貨日期

  • DLV_ITEMS | |導入|無需參考即可創建交付物品

  • SERIAL_NUMBERS | X |導入|序列號

  • EXTENSION_IN | X |導入|附加輸入數據

  • 交貨| X |導出|生成的交貨

  • CREATED_ITEMS | X |導出|生成的送貨項目

  • EXTENSION_OUT | X |導出|額外的輸出數據

  • RETURN | X |導出|錯誤日誌

我不確定是否有這樣的BAPI只模擬向外交貨。您可以使用的解決方法是在不調用BAPI_TRANSACTION_COMMIT的情況下調用此BAPI,然後在已經有COMMIT的情況下執行ROLLBACK WORK。

+0

是!謝謝@Marco。我也瀏覽了這個FM的文檔,這很好。 – Czarinaaaaa29